Synonyms: graceful

Definition: characterized by beauty of movement, style, form, or execution

Similar words: elegant

Definition: displaying effortless beauty and simplicity in movement or execution

Usage: an elegant dancer; an elegant mathematical solution -- simple and precise


Similar words: fluent, fluid, smooth, liquid

Definition: smooth and unconstrained in movement

Usage: a long, smooth stride; the fluid motion of a cat; the liquid grace of a ballerina


Similar words: gainly

Definition: graceful and pleasing

Usage: gainly conduct; a gainly youth with dark hair and eyes


Similar words: gracile, willowy

Definition: slender and graceful


Similar words: lissom, lissome, lithe, lithesome, slender, supple, svelte, sylphlike

Definition: moving and bending with ease


Synonyms: graceful, elegant, refined

Definition: suggesting taste, ease, and wealth

Similar words: gracious

Definition: characterized by charm, good taste, and generosity of spirit

Usage: gracious even to unexpected visitors; gracious living; he bears insult with gracious good humor
